MAXIMUMが投稿した記事

現場の運用工程で求められそうなVBA知識

MAXIMUM に投稿

こんな感じで.txtや.datなどの入力データを加工するVBAが作れる為、現場でそういったツールが求められたりする

https://chatgpt.com/share/685bff48-6e28-8008-9a44-c94bd4028bd5

注意点として0を文字列扱いにするためにVBAやマクロの対象になっているシートの左上押下で全選択後に文字列に設定する必要がある

ただ、ここら辺の問題はPower Queryという新しい仕組みで解決しているため、現場レベルでもVBAから置き換わって行くかもしれない

ファイルを上の階層に持ってくる.bat

MAXIMUM に投稿

Windowsエクスプローラー等で、ウィンマージなどを動かしたい時に、トリガーになるファイルを整理する必要がありますが、

これを全部いちいち手動で配置していると面倒なうえ、膨大な時間(工数)が掛かるため、自動化したい

この際に最も便利なのが、.batファイル

ターミナル等で打ったりするよりも流用が効きやすいのがメリット

意外と.batを作らずに手動で移動している人も多いので、この発想に至れば良いなとchatGPTのリンクを共有

https://chatgpt.com/share/682795ca-1cc4-8008-ba47-e0ac4319326a

カバレッジの上げ方

MAXIMUM に投稿

タグ

JUnitテストケースを作成したけれど、カバレッジを上げたい!となった時のひとつの例を上げる

例えば、以下のような正常系のテストケースがあったとする

// 正常系のテスト
@Test
public void testAddition() {
    Calculator calculator = new Calculator();
    int result = calculator.add(2, 3);
    assertEquals(5, result);
}